diff --git a/backend/src/main/java/moadong/club/controller/ClubApplyController.java b/backend/src/main/java/moadong/club/controller/ClubApplyController.java
index c8c90e2ac..2158a430f 100644
--- a/backend/src/main/java/moadong/club/controller/ClubApplyController.java
+++ b/backend/src/main/java/moadong/club/controller/ClubApplyController.java
@@ -72,7 +72,7 @@ public ResponseEntity> getApplyInfo(@PathVariable String clubId,
@PutMapping("/apply/{appId}")
@Operation(summary = "지원서 변경",
- description = "클럽 자원자의 지원서 정보를 수정합니다.
"
+ description = "클럽 지원자의 지원서 정보를 수정합니다.
"
+ "appId - 지원서 아이디"
)
@PreAuthorize("isAuthenticated()")
@@ -87,7 +87,7 @@ public ResponseEntity> editApplicantDetail(@PathVariable String clubId,
@DeleteMapping("/apply/{appId}")
@Operation(summary = "지원서 삭제",
- description = "클럽 자원자의 지원서를 삭제합니다.
"
+ description = "클럽 지원자의 지원서를 삭제합니다.
"
+ "appId - 지원서 아이디"
)
@PreAuthorize("isAuthenticated()")
diff --git a/backend/src/main/java/moadong/club/enums/ApplicationStatus.java b/backend/src/main/java/moadong/club/enums/ApplicationStatus.java
index f1f712a6f..7050a5712 100644
--- a/backend/src/main/java/moadong/club/enums/ApplicationStatus.java
+++ b/backend/src/main/java/moadong/club/enums/ApplicationStatus.java
@@ -1,17 +1,8 @@
package moadong.club.enums;
public enum ApplicationStatus {
- DRAFT, // 작성 중
SUBMITTED, // 제출 완료
- SCREENING, // 서류 심사 중
- SCREENING_PASSED, // 서류 통과
- SCREENING_FAILED, // 서류 탈락
INTERVIEW_SCHEDULED, // 면접 일정 확정
- INTERVIEW_IN_PROGRESS, // 면접 진행 중
- INTERVIEW_PASSED, // 면접 통과
- INTERVIEW_FAILED, // 면접 탈락
- OFFERED, // 최종 합격 제안
- ACCEPTED, // 제안 수락
- DECLINED, // 제안 거절
- CANCELED_BY_APPLICANT // 지원자 자진 철회
+ ACCEPTED, // 합격
+ DECLINED, // 불합
}
\ No newline at end of file
diff --git a/backend/src/main/java/moadong/club/service/ClubApplyService.java b/backend/src/main/java/moadong/club/service/ClubApplyService.java
index 2bef509df..814354565 100644
--- a/backend/src/main/java/moadong/club/service/ClubApplyService.java
+++ b/backend/src/main/java/moadong/club/service/ClubApplyService.java
@@ -110,9 +110,9 @@ public ClubApplyInfoResponse getClubApplyInfo(String clubId, CustomUserDetails u
applications.add(ClubApplicantsResult.of(app, cipher));
switch (app.getStatus()) {
- case SUBMITTED, SCREENING -> reviewRequired++;
- case SCREENING_PASSED, INTERVIEW_SCHEDULED, INTERVIEW_IN_PROGRESS -> scheduledInterview++;
- case INTERVIEW_PASSED, OFFERED, ACCEPTED -> accepted++;
+ case SUBMITTED -> reviewRequired++;
+ case INTERVIEW_SCHEDULED -> scheduledInterview++;
+ case ACCEPTED -> accepted++;
}
}